| Hey Guys, I'm wondering if anyone can help with this. As the title says, Whenever I try to enter the National Guard Recruiting Office, my game crashes. Sometimes just being near that area crashes my game. i also think it's definitely worth noting that I've been in the building before, and not had this issue. And yes I restarted the game. _________________ |

| I had a similar problem when I went to the cell containing back street apparel. It caused an immediate ctd. I had not made any changes or updates on mods since I last went there nor was a patch causing the problem. I confirmed the games files were ok and it was still causing problems. To fix the problem I loaded an earlier game and went to the area. When I found one that did not have a crash I loaded the game having problems - without dropping to the main menu.. I was then able to enter the area with no ctd. I did a full save and then dropped to the desktop before reloading.
Oblivion, Skyrim, FO3, FONV and apparently FO4 do not clear everything out of memory when you load a game when one is currently running. Because of that you sometimes can get lucky and resolve some minor game corruption when it occurs. It doesnt work all the time but in my case it did.
Hope this helps... _________________ - KCCO
